I’ve just got out the neck (pics to follow). And the neck is slightly too big, I’m talking fractions, it could be forced in it’s that close, but could cause some damage. So a little sanding and it should be perfect. It’s a great body. 3rd one I’ve got from them. I know guitar build offer two sizes on their 51/54 bodies. They offer original 50s size (62.8mm) and reissue size (63.5). Reissue is bigger than original, so might be worth looking at that.
